The Millers

The Millers is an American sitcom on the CBS multi -camera format. The idea for the series had Greg Garcia. In the United States, the series had on October 3, 2013 following The Big Bang Theory premiere, in Germany it radiates Prosieben since February 4, 2014.

In March 2014 CBS extended the series to a second season.

Action

The focus of the series is Nathan Miller, a recently divorced local reporter whose life has stuck to the start of series. Due to the fact that he was held by his parents always for the successful child, he concealed them several months his divorce from wife Janice. But when his parents find out one days of the divorce, father wants Tom after 43 years of marriage, the divorce from mother Carol, what Nathan and his sister Debbie quite surprised. In connection with this statement turns out that her parents' marriage has broken down for years, but the two still wanted to act as role models for their children. As a consequence of the separation of Tom and Carol Tom moves in with his daughter Debbie, her husband Adam and their daughter Mikayla and Carol to her son Nathan.

Production

On January 18, 2013 CBS ordered a pilot episode titled Unauthorized Greg Garcia pilot, which was written by Greg Garcia and James Burrows directed.

First, Will Arnett has signed on the central main role, however, was at that time still uncertain if he were available, since he was still at NBC's Up All Night under contract. The series, however, was discontinued in May 2013. Next, Margo Martindale has been cast in the role of mother. Shortly afterwards, the role of Nathan's friend Ray with JB Smoove and his sister Debbie has been busy with Mary Elizabeth Ellis. In early March came Beau Bridges as Nathan's father and Michael Rapaport as Debbie's husband added to the occupation.

On May 10, CBS ordered the series under the title The Millers. Shortly after ordering the series left Mary Elizabeth Ellis and Michael Rapaport the series. Just two months later, the roles of the two with Jayma Mays and Nelson Franklin were occupied. Mid- August 2013 gained the recurring role of Nathan's ex-wife Janice Eliza Coupe.

The premiere of the series took place behind an episode of The Big Bang Theory on October 3, 2013. Due to almost constant ratings CBS stopped the episode number of the series in October 2013 by the so-called back nine order of 13 to 22. On March 11, 2014, the renewal for a second season was announced.

Broadcast

The first episode of the series aired on October 3, 2013 on CBS and watched by 13.09 million viewers.

After ProSiebenSat.1 Media had secured the broadcast rights already in June 2013, it can be seen since February 4, 2014 on ProSieben.

Reception

Leanne Aguilera and Jenna Mullins of E! Online said that " wonderful occupation" ( "wonderful cast" ) gives them a piece of hope. Diane value of Newsday assessed the television series A-. David Hinckley of the New York Daily News awarded to the sitcom 1 of 5 stars. Says Nina Rehfeld of the FAZ, Greg Garcia had a " created so old-fashioned comedy series that makes you feel like in a repetition of the eighties ".
